S. Korean Authorities Urged to Make Apology and Reparation for Massacres of Civilians
Pyongyang, December 4 (KCNA) -- The south Korean joint fact-finding group for unearthing remains of civilians killed during the Korean war which consists of the Institute for National Studies and other organizations held a press conference in Seoul on Dec. 2 at which it demanded the "government" make an apology and reparation for the massacres of civilians, according to KBS of south Korea.

On February 24 the fact-finding group started the work for unearthing remains of civilians mercilessly killed during the June 25 Korean war. In this course remains and relics of civilians were discovered in Jinju, South Kyongsang Province in March.

Bereaved families and members of civic and public organizations demanded an apology and reparation for the massacres of civilians committed by the Syngman Rhee regime in the past but the present authorities have not taken any measure.

Disclosing this fact, the joint fact-finding group said it would conduct the work for unearthing remains in the future, too, and probe the truth about the mass killings of civilians.

It also demanded the "government" opt for probing the truth at an early date, make an apology to the bereaved families and institute a law to make reparation.
